[Remote] SR ANALYST FP&A

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Envision Healthcare is a leading national medical group focused on delivering high-quality care to patients. The Senior FP&A Analyst leads complex financial analysis, budgeting, forecasting, and reporting to support strategic decision-making for assigned business areas, while also mentoring Financial Analysts and driving process improvements.

Responsibilities

  • Conducts monthly, quarterly, and annual financial analyses for assigned business areas, delivering accurate, well-supported insights that inform leadership decision-making
  • Supports month-end close activities that are difficult and sometimes complex, including volume estimation, accrual development, and reconciliation review to ensure integrity of financial results
  • Performs advanced variance analysis, interpreting results against budget, forecast, and prior year; synthesizes findings into clear, actionable commentary tailored for leadership and cross-functional partners
  • Develops and maintains comprehensive annual budgets and integrated forecast models; ensures alignment with strategic and operational objectives
  • Designs, enhances, and governs financial reporting templates and dashboards supporting planning cycles, performance reviews, and operational reporting
  • Identifies, proposes, and drives opportunities for process improvement, automation, and reporting efficiency within FP&A workflows
  • Executes complex ad hoc analyses and provides analytical leadership on special projects, strategic initiatives, and executive-level reporting needs
  • Serves as a mentor and day‑to‑day resource for Financial Analysts, providing guidance, training, and developmental feedback to support skill growth and analytical quality
  • Acts as a liaison between analysts, management, and cross‑functional partners, ensuring effective communication, alignment on priorities, and consistent delivery of financial insights
  • Oversees the structure, maintenance, and accuracy of ERP metadata for assigned business areas to ensure consistent and reliable financial reporting
  • Other duties as assigned
